Modern Luxe

 
 

Sink into it. Feel the soft textures in the textiles, furniture, the flooring, beams, trim, lighting, etc. This isn’t just visual; it’s touch sensory too. This style makes you feel rich and luxurious, with simple, clean design. It has elements of midcentury minimal design mixed with rustic style - making this gorgeous new traditional look so many love.

Rustic Farmhouse

We have been in love with the rustic farmhouse, or the modern farmhouse. With warm greige colors and woods that add warmth to the space making it feel relaxed and broken in. The Shabby Chic of the 21st century.

Traditional

Traditional is making a comeback! It’s got a little more romance to it, fairytale castle feel. It has a classic elegance with a more ornate finish - timeless and sophisticated.

Modern

The modern style is a Minimalist’s preference. It’s open, airy and uncluttered. It appreciates the emphasis on geometric lines. It makes space for color.

Industrial

We normally think of industrial in the home to be more of the lighting design and materials than the style of the home. Industrial lights are used with all of the other styles. The heavy dark metal is a good contrast to whites of a farmhouse style and gives a boost to the rustic style. It’s design is an homage to the history of our warehouses and farms of the past.

Boho

That breezy beachy feel…. Who doesn’t love it? Put it in your beach house, or put wherever you want that preppy, natural, sun-kissed feeling. Think natural materials in rattan, bamboo, and hemp with a wide array of weaves.

 

Glam

Adds the sparkle and rich feel to your room. There are large and elaborate pieces to smaller with a more refined amount of bling. Either way, they get a ‘Wow!’ when people see them.
